Outline

A large programming project using Java. Students work in teams of about five people.


Aims

The aims of this module are to:

  • provide experience of working in a team
  • provide experience of building a larger and more complex piece of software than is usual in the Software Workshop
  • expose students to the application areas of graphics, databases and user interface design

Learning Outcomes

On successful completion of this module, the student should be able to: Assessed by:
1work in a team, managing themselves and others effectively Diary, Report
2design a large software system by breaking it into modules and allocating resources Viva, Report
3describe the construction of a large software system Report
4integrate knowledge of databases, graphics and human-computer interaction from other modules Viva, Report

Assessment

  • Supplementary (where allowed): As the sessional assessment
  • Continuous assessment (100%) (diary, report, practical demonstration). Normally students who fail can be reassessed only by repeating. Nevertheless, students with marginal failures may be permitted to do additional work instead of being required to repeat the module.
